"We have been coming to Connemara for 34 years, and this house is in the perfect spot for us. Not only do you get gorgeous views over the tranquil Betraboy Bay, but on the other side of the bay you can see Roundstone and round to the east, the Twelve Pins mountain range. The house is impeccably designed so that all the communal living spaces are functional and spacious, while somehow managing to fit in five spacious bedrooms where you can be tucked away with some quiet and privacy. It really is a functional house for a large family gathering. The house has an abundance of options when it comes to different facilities, from washing machines and dryers to dishwashers and ways to dry out beach kit. There's plenty of garden space for kids to run around, has good Wi-Fi, everything you could ever hope for when booking a house for a week. On top of that, John and Mairead were incredibly helpful and courteous, quick to respond with any queries we had. They really made us feel at home. Some people in other reviews have mentioned that Glinsk is a remote area, and this is true. It's definitely as asset. This is why you can enjoy local beaches, walks and mountains without the hundreds of tourists that are now flocking to other parts of Ireland's coast. There are plenty of shops and coffee shops nearby - within a ten-minute drive you can get all the basics, but Clifden, just 30 minutes away, has all the big supermarkets where you can get everything you could ever need. Highly recommend."

Best time to go to Carna

The best time to visit Carna can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Carna falls in August, when vis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ain. The coolest average temperature in Carna falls in January and February. February has average visitor numbers and mostly cloudy weather.

calendar iconCalendar Monthtemperature iconTemperaturerain iconPrecipitationmostly cloudy iconCloudinessoccupation rate iconOccupancyprice iconPricing
January44.2°F (6.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
February44.2°F (6.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
March45.0°F (7.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
April47.7°F (8.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ately HighAverage
May51.1°F (10.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
June55.2°F (12.9°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ately HighSlightly High
July57.7°F (14.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ately HighSlightly High
August58.1°F (14.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
September56.7°F (13.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
October53.2°F (11.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ately LowAverage
November48.4°F (9.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ately LowAverage
December45.7°F (7.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ately LowAverage

What's the weather like in Carna?
The hottest months are usually August and July with an average temp of 57°F, while the coldest months are February and March with an average of 45°F. Average annual precipitation for Carna is 48 inches.
